Wilson leads senior MGP practice

Scott Wilson set the fastest time in Tuesday's evening's Manx Grand Prix practice session in near-perfect conditions on the Isle of Man.

Wilson completed a lap of the Mountain Course at an average speed of 117.618mph to top the senior class.

Manxman Ryan Kneen continued where he left off on Monday, putting down a 117.363mph lap in the juniors.

Sulby rider Dan Sayle was quickest in the lightweight class with Joe Phillips fastest in the ultra-lightweight.

Sean Murphy was the fastest newcomer setting a lap of 116.436mph.

Oliver Linsdell was quickest in the Senior Classic with 106.339mph whilst Chris McGahan topped the Junior Classic.

David Smith, Roy Richardson and Frank James topped the remaining classes.

The next practice session is scheduled for Wednesday evening with roads closing at 1800 BST.
